What does a flow meter measure in a wastewater treatment setting?

A flow meter is an essential instrument in wastewater treatment that measures the volume of wastewater entering a treatment facility. Understanding flow is crucial for managing the treatment process effectively, as it helps operators determine the amount of incoming wastewater that needs processing. This measurement enables operators to adapt the treatment processes to the varying inflow to ensure optimal treatment efficiency.

Monitoring the flow allows for more accurate calculations of loading rates for various treatment units, which is vital for maintaining system performance and compliance with discharge permits. For instance, knowing the volume of incoming wastewater can help operators decide how to adjust chemical dosing, aeration, or other treatment parameters to ensure that the system can handle the load without overwhelming its capacity.

Measuring temperature or the concentration of pollutants pertains to other types of laboratory equipment and sensors that assess water quality. The density of sludge is typically measured with different specific instruments that evaluate the characteristics of solid materials rather than the flow of liquid.
